The official podcast of MetalSucks, Petar Spajic, Brandon Hahn and Jozalyn Sharp. One featured interview each week with a prominent metal musician, and discussion of the latest headlines in metal news. New episodes every Monday morning.

    Sam Dunn, director, producer, anthropologist and co-owner of Banger Films is our guest this week. He has become the de facto record-keeper for heavy metal, having produced Metal: A Headbanger's Journey, Metal Evolution, Global Metal and more focused documentaries about Iron Maiden, Rush and now Super Duper Alice Cooper. Sam tells us the history of a legend who so many of us know little to nothing about, and we pick his brain to find out who might be next, how he became a metal filmmaker and more.
